What happened

A batch of Wired security stories highlights a spike in state-level and criminal misuse of cyber and electromagnetic capabilities: GPS/electronic-warfare attacks near Iran and against ships and consumer navigation apps (affecting ~1,100 ships) are disrupting logistics and mapping; hundreds of attempts to hijack consumer security cameras—timed to strikes—show a growing battlefield use of IoT compromises; a sophisticated iPhone-hacking toolkit (likely built for a government) appears to have leaked and is now in the hands of foreign spies and criminals, potentially infecting tens of thousands of
